Transaction 776596fc4f097c729ebd4571bbc25e4cf431ded0f77360ae853128c47057b60a

2 Input
2 Outputs
  • 776596fc4f097c729ebd4571bbc25e4cf431ded0f77360ae853128c47057b60a:0
  • value  1048059
    address  3Ecq8XLxvt6eLAg2YSh3praPC6fzW5M1Mn
  • 776596fc4f097c729ebd4571bbc25e4cf431ded0f77360ae853128c47057b60a:1
  • value  462253
    address  3GQUhcUJPWwLQWbvcTFgui8fKMDMJrNMpG